Output 20628079fa1642e01a602572e0dc6bf87d545ef400b9223893fa20a001ec6aa8:0

value
684947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4568ac9799eccac9ad360d37f64a87e986acb681 OP_EQUAL
address
3821wfpeuWjetRnWAQeJA43zTARgecHxDU
transaction
20628079fa1642e01a602572e0dc6bf87d545ef400b9223893fa20a001ec6aa8
spent
true